Nonsterile Utility Drapes, 200 EA/CS

Nonsterile utility drapes are general-purpose surgical drapes packed for case purchasing. They fit facilities that need a larger-volume supply for procedural areas and want a standard Medline drape option. This case includes 200 drapes and the line uses SMS fabric with five fiber layers for high barrier strength.
